What Are THCA Flowers?
THCA flowers are buds from cannabis plants that have not been decarboxylated. This means they contain THCA, the acidic precursor to THC, which is known for its psychoactive effects. However, THCA itself does not produce a high. Instead, it offers various health benefits that are garnering attention from researchers and consumers alike.
The Science Behind THCA
Understanding the chemical structure of THCA helps in comprehending how it interacts with our body. When exposed to heat (like smoking or cooking), THCA converts to THC. But in its raw form, it binds differently to cannabinoid receptors in our endocannabinoid system.

Myths vs Facts About THCA Flowers
Misconceptions often cloud public perception of cannabis products:
Myth 1: All Cannabis Gets You High
Fact: Only decarboxylated cannabis (that which contains THC) will produce psychoactive effects.
Myth 2: All Cannabinoids Are Dangerous
Fact: Many cannabinoids like THCA offer therapeutic benefits without risks associated with THC.
